Clinton is a city located in the eastern part of the state of Iowa, along the Mississippi River. With a population of around 25,000 people, it is the county seat of Clinton County. The city is known for its rich history, diverse culture, and beautiful natural surroundings.

Clinton has a thriving economy, with a strong industrial base that includes manufacturing, agriculture, and healthcare industries. The city is home to several major companies, including Archer Daniels Midland, Nestle Purina PetCare, and LyondellBasell. These industries provide a significant number of jobs to the local community and contribute to the overall economic development of the region.

The city of Clinton offers a wide range of recreational opportunities for its residents and visitors. The Mississippi River provides a picturesque backdrop for outdoor activities such as fishing, boating, and birdwatching. Additionally, the city has several beautiful parks and trails that are perfect for hiking, biking, and picnicking.

Clinton has a rich cultural heritage, with a number of historical sites and landmarks that are worth visiting. The George M. Curtis Mansion, a Victorian-era home that has been restored to its former glory, offers guided tours that provide a fascinating glimpse into the city’s past. The Clinton County Historical Society Museum showcases artifacts and exhibits that chronicle the history of the region, from its early settlement to its present-day developments.

The city also hosts several annual events and festivals that celebrate its heritage and traditions. The Clinton County Fair, held in July, is a popular event that features livestock competitions, carnival rides, and live entertainment. The Riverboat Days festival in June offers a variety of family-friendly activities, including a parade, fireworks, and live music.
